Marika Konings is the Policy Director at ICANN, where she manages policy development activities in support of the GNSO. [1][2]

Education

Konings holds a bachelor's degree in Culture and Science from the University of Maastricht, and a Master's degree in European Political And Administrative studies from the College of Europe in Bruges, Belgium. [3]

Career History

Marika was the Director at Cyber Security Industry Alliance before she joined ICANN in July, 2008.[4] Prior to that, she worked at a Brussels-based public affairs consultancy for seven years.[5]
